Output 53c28b69af06f48d3ad339017343896f67eb10d840ba821431b6ed98e84f0c5f:2

value
33574324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fad043b6957d8bf808cf5b9eaaa2a5694a5a0804 OP_EQUAL
address
3QZCLyNsDQH75sCnGTGhkbVHsJYQsPBfkm
transaction
53c28b69af06f48d3ad339017343896f67eb10d840ba821431b6ed98e84f0c5f
spent
true